Survivors of the December 1984 Bhopal Gas disaster participate in a protest held in New Delhi, India, 12 July 2012. According to a press statement the survivors of the 1984 Bhopal Gas disaster demanded from the Group of Ministers (GOM) on Bhopal to ensure adequate compensation to be given against the health damages caused by the 1984 Bhopal Gas disaster by Union Carbide and Dow Chemicals. According to official data, the gas disaster killed 15,274 people although assessments by groups such as Greenpeace say 25,000 died. According to a media report, Dow Chemical is one of the many worldwide partners of the London Olympics 2012 and critizised due to it's links to the 1984 Bhopal Gas disaster. EPA/ANINDITO MUKHERJEE
